General description
  • goods produced by the American brand Barnett
  • made of the highest quality materials
  • converts the diaphragm clutch spring into six coil springs and provides more progressive, linear engagement
  • includes a precision CNC-machined aluminum pressure plate, six heavy-duty coil springs, spring cups and stainless steel bolts
  • replaces the standard pressure plate/spring without modification
